Hydrological & Water Models
Understand how water moves across the landscape.
From rainfall to runoff, erosion to floods, these models help you quantify and predict water behaviour — the foundation of watershed, hydrology, and disaster studies.
Models
SCS Curve Number (CN) Model
Estimates direct runoff volume from rainfall events based on soil types and land cover characteristics.

Soil Erosion Models (USLE, RUSLE)
Predicts long-term annual rates of soil loss caused by rainfall, terrain factors, and land management.

Flood Modeling (HEC-RAS, MIKE)
Simulates river flow hydraulics, mapping inundation depth boundaries and hazards.

Rainfall-Runoff Models (SWAT)
Watershed-scale continuous simulation tools estimating water, sediment, and chemical yields.
